Gazette published declaring 6 seats of BNP lawmakers vacant

The Parliament Secretariat on Sunday night published a gazette notification declaring the seats of six lawmakers of BNP vacant.

The six lawmakers are Md Zahidur Rahman MP from Thakurgaon-3 constituency, Md Mosharof Hosen MP from Bogura-4, Gulam Mohammad Siraj MP from Bogura-7, Md Aminul Islam MP from Chapainawabganj-2, Abdus Sattar Bhuiyan from Brahmanbaria-2 and Rumeen Farhana MP for reserved seat for women.

Two other lawmakers Md Harunur Rashid MP for Chapainawabganj-3 is currently abroad while Brahmanbaria-2 MP Abdus Sattar Bhuiyan could not appear in the parliament due to his illness.

Earlier yesterday morning, five of the seven BNP MPs submitted their resignations to Jatiya Sangsad (JS) Speaker Dr Shirin Sharmin Chaudhury as part of their anti-government movement with a 10-point demand that includes dissolution of parliament.

They went to the parliament around 11am and handed in their resignation letters in person.

But, Brahmanbaria-2 MP Abdus Sattar Bhuiyan could not appear physically due to his illness.
